9. Fieldbus interface | 9.2 - Scale protocol | 118
Field Function
ADUError AD conversion error (OR function of bits E1, E3, E7).
AboveMax The weight value has exceeded the Max (FSD), but is still
within Max + permissible overload (gross ≤Max + over
load).
Overload The weight value has exceeded the measuring range. No
valid weight data is specified (gross >Max + overload);
ERR2.
BelowZero The weight value is negative (gross < 0d).
CenterZero The weight value is within center zero (0 ± 0.25 d)
InsideZSR The gross weight value is within the zero setting range.
Standstill The scale is stable.
OutOfRange Below zero or above Max (FSD).
E9 The measuring signal is higher than the permissible range
of 36mV. Cannot read weight values from ADC (ana
log-digital converter) (ERR 9).
E7 The measuring signal is negative (inverse conversion) (ERR
7)
E6 Sense voltage not present or too low (ERR 6)
E3 The measuring signal is >36mV (no end of conversion)
(ERR 3)
CmdError Error during execution (CmdError); e.g., the "taring" oper
ation is not processed, because the scale is not at a stand
still. The error is stored in LastError (function number 4).
The bit is reset with the ResetError bit (function num
ber121, see ChapterFunction number 112–121: transi
tion-controlled action bits (write)).
ActionActive The device is busy executing a function (e.g., waiting for
downtime for taring).
PowerFail Power failure; is always set after power on. The PowerFail
bit is reset with the ResetPWF bit (function number 85, see
ChapterFunction number 80–89: state-controlled action
bits (write)) "Reset power failure".
